第一個鴻蒙程序Hello Word


DevEco Studio介紹

HUAWEI DevEco Studio(以下簡稱DevEco Studio)是基於IntelliJ IDEA Community開源版本打造,面向華為終端全場景多設備的一站式集成開發環境(IDE),為開發者提供工程模板創建、開發、編譯、調試、發布等E2E的HarmonyOS應用開發服務。通過使用DevEco Studio,開發者可以更高效的開發具備HarmonyOS分布式能力的應用,進而提升創新效率。

下載與安裝軟件

登錄HarmonysOS應用開發門戶,點擊右上角注冊按鈕,注冊開發者帳號,注冊指導參考注冊華為開發者聯盟帳號。如果已有華為開發者聯盟帳號,請直接點擊登錄按鈕。

DevEco Studio下載跟安裝:

https://developer.harmonyos.com/cn/develop/deveco-studio

DevEco Studio的編譯構建依賴JDK,DevEco Studio預置了Open JDK,版本為1.8,安裝過程中會自動安裝JDK。

下載和安裝Node.js:

https://nodejs.org/zh-cn/download/

設置npm倉庫

為了提升下載JS SDK時,使用npm安裝JS依賴的速度,建議在命令行工具(Mac系統為“終端”工具)中執行如下命令,重新設置npm倉庫地址。

npm config set registry https://repo.huaweicloud.com/repository/npm/

用DevEco Studio新建一個項目

安裝好工具跟node.js之后,打開DevEco Studio,首頁如下圖所示:

DevEco Studio首頁

然后點擊Create HarmonyOS Project按鈕新建一個項目,進入選擇模版界面,在模版界面下選擇Phone跟Empty Feature Ability(Java),這里需要選擇Phone大家很好理解,代表手機開發,但是為什么選擇Empty Feature Ability,后續的章節我們會介紹Ability是什么?

選擇模版

選擇了模版之后,點擊Next按鈕,進入配置項目界面,這個頁面有四個輸入框,依次是:項目名稱、包名、項目保存路徑、編譯API版本!做個Android開發的朋友對這些項目配置信息應該都很熟悉了,這里就不做過多介紹了。

項目配置

項目配置信息這里我就用系統默認的了,點擊Finish按鈕,一個新的項目就創建成功啦。

項目目錄結構

使用模擬器運行

目前為止市場上還沒有帶鴻蒙操作系統的手機,現在大家只能用模擬器調試運行,點擊菜單欄工具:Tools->HVD Manager,這個時候會打開瀏覽器驗證您的華為開發者賬號,驗證完成之后會打開模擬器設備管理界面,我們點擊Phone,選擇只有一款模擬器,華為P40手機,雙擊P40手機所在的行,就會啟動模擬器。

選擇設備

啟動模擬器之后,在開發工具右邊就有一個小手機啦,然后點擊工具欄上的運行按鈕運行按鈕,選擇我們的模擬器運行,運行之后模擬器上顯示一行文字“Hello Word”,第一個鴻蒙程序就此誕生啦。

運行Hello Word

總結

以上所有的內容在鴻蒙操作系統官網都有,大家可以訪問官網學習更多知識,當然也可以關注我的公眾號,后期會一直更新,我會一直學習鴻蒙開發,然后把內容總結發布到公眾號。官方開發者官網如下:

https://www.harmonyos.com/cn/develop

如果你之前是Android開發者,學習鴻蒙開發上手會很快,主要有以下幾點:

  1. 開發工具基於IntelliJ IDEA Community,跟Android Studio是一個爸爸
  2. 開發語言支持Java
  3. 項目結構,還有代碼風格跟Android很像,反正我第一次看到這個項目結構的時候很容易看懂。

如果你想第一時間看我的后期文章,掃碼關注公眾號,長期推送Android開發文章、最新動態、開源項目,讓你各種漲姿勢。

      Android開發666 - 安卓開發技術分享
             掃描二維碼加關注

Android開發666


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M